Photo d'archive : Oscar Niemeyer (1907-2012) à gauche et Lucio Costa (1902-1998) à droite en 1957 au moment des travaux de Brasilia dans le pavillon du Brésil de la biennale d'architecture 2014 Le projet de Brasilia a été conçu par les architectes Oscar Niemeyer (principaux bâtiments publics) et Lucio Costa (plan d'urbanisme, concours de 1957). Brasilia a été inauguré en 1960 après 1000 jours de travaux Articles de Wikipedia sur les deux architectes fr.wikipedia.org/wiki/Oscar_Niemeyer fr.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lucio_Costa Pour illustrer le thème "Absorbing modernity 1914-2014" de la biennale internationale d'architecture de Venise de 2014, le Pavillon du Brésil présente une évolution chronologique de l'architecture de son pays, qui se caractérise par une relation intime à la modernité. Des maquettes , des documents et des photos de 180 bâtiments remarquables constituent l'exposition du pavillon du Brésil, complétée par un catalogue complet sur ce thème.
